Connie G. Barwick, your Guide to Cross Stitch, has been an avid Cross Stitcher for more than thirty years. She enjoys teaching people basic stitches, designing patterns, and sharing tips and tricks with experienced stitchers.

Connie's patterns are inspired by her varied interests which include reading, music, and exploring her natural surroundings. Some of the charts are based on questions or suggestions from About.com Cross Stitch members.

Experience:

When Connie was eight, she completed her first Stamped Cross Stitch design. She transitioned to Counted Cross Stitch a few years later and has been hooked since. She developed her knowledge of Cross Stitch with help from other stitchers, by reading books and magazines, and by trying out new techniques. She continues to develop her knowledge by reading new publications and trying out new products. Connie is also a freelance craft writer for Kooler Design Studio.

From Connie G. Barwick:

Over the years, I have probably made every Cross Stitch mistake possible, but I used those learning experiences to improve my stitching. I love teaching beginning stitchers and discussing stitching techniques with experienced stitchers.

I really enjoy designing patterns, especially abstract geometrics and samplers. Some of my favorite designs are based on quilt blocks.

No matter where I have lived or what type of work I have done, Cross Stitch has been a constant companion. I’ve stitched between classes, in ICU waiting rooms, on my lunch hour - I take a project with me wherever I go.
